In this video, I explain and demonstrate some considerations about sidechain ducking sounds to other sounds, in the context of the CTZ approach. This is episode 14 in a series about how to mix for loudness, in large part by using a specific approach to gainstaging and dynamic range control that I call the "Clip-to-Zero (CTZ) strategy".

0:00 - In this video
1:17 - Duck EVERYTHING to the loudest framework sounds
5:18 - Don't forget to duck your aux/FX returns too
6:20 - Don't forget to duck your drum tops too
8:44 - Duck on busses, not on tracks
11:40 - Every bus needs a different ducking length and shape
17:04 - Use spectral duckers for vocals
